442333223 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 442333224. Its totient is φ = 442333222.

The previous prime is 442333193. The next prime is 442333249. The reversal of 442333223 is 322333244.

It is an a-pointer prime, because the next prime (442333249) can be obtained adding 442333223 to its sum of digits (26).

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 442333223 - 28 = 442332967 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 442333192 and 442333201.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(442333273)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 221166611 + 221166612.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(221166612).

Almost surely, 2442333223 is an apocalyptic number.

442333223 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

442333223 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

442333223 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its digits is 10368, while the sum is 26.

The square root of 442333223 is about 21031.7194494411. The cubic root of 442333223 is about 761.9325373185.

Adding to 442333223 its reverse (322333244), we get a palindrome (764666467).

The spelling of 442333223 in words is "four hundred forty-two million, three hundred thirty-three thousand, two hundred twenty-three".
